Another memory of this RI train: Santa Fe and Rock Island had separate stations in Amarillo. If you had a through ticket from The Santa Fe SF Chief to a location on the RI line, the railroad provided transportation between stations. It was provided by a very decrepit former school bus that emitted more smoke than an Alco diesel at its worst. Passenger load on the bus was usually two or three people at most.

In spite of the very limited passenger traffic on this line, station agents and train crews did their best to provide very good service. Every time I rode it the RDC was always right on time.

Looking at the ghosts of the past was interesting. For example, the fairly late Oklahoma City union station had a large empty space where a restaurant had been at one time (possibly a Harvey House).
